Transaction 1654d33c250cebaadbd619770e38f0fc9f470a486d647ef99a36580b9ea52594
2 Input
2 Outputs
- 1654d33c250cebaadbd619770e38f0fc9f470a486d647ef99a36580b9ea52594:0
- 1654d33c250cebaadbd619770e38f0fc9f470a486d647ef99a36580b9ea52594:1
value 17186518
address 3NPzLv1Jy4vhCgavfz6Zt7injzaHMUuJYk
value 5006705
address 3HX83Ft8QcXroLYAiEGnMQHfvieeZDMqHv